#dbd4d4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#dbd4d4 is composed of 85.9% red, 83.1%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 3.2% magenta, 3.2% yellow and 14.1% black. It has a hue angle of 0 degrees, a saturation of 8.9% and a lightness of 84.5%. #dbd4d4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#b7a9a9.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#dbd4d4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#dbd4d4 has RGB values of R:219, G:212, B:212 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.03, Y:0.03,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 14406868.
